REPORT: 2021 WORLD JUNIORS
Mikko Petman has thrived in a fourth-line role at the World Juniors. The winger plays a heavy game and works at both ends of the ice. He has a strong stick and wins loose pucks. He has situational toughness and the strength and balance to play through contact – doesn’t mind going into crowded areas. He is a willing shot blocker on the penalty kill. In the offensive zone, he is poised with the puck and can hold on to it until he recognizes an opportunity for a pass or a shot. He has decent speed, plays well in straight lines and keeps the puck moving north – a simple, yet effective approach. He had a few scoring chances in the quarterfinals against Sweden, but wasn’t able to take advantage of them. But he was very energetic and noticeable in that game and he may well play in a bigger role as Finland takes on USA in the semifinals. He has already played almost 80 pro games in the Liiga and it shows in his physicality and reliability away from the puck.
